United States Court of Appeals FOR THE EIGHTH CIRCUIT
No. 97-1607 Charles Virg Hyde, Appellant, v. Curtis H. Evans, County Judge, York County Courthouse, York, Nebraska; Mark K. Hyde; John R. Brogan, Attorney; Dale Radcliff, Sheriff, York County, Nebraska; David A. Hyde; Luella R. Hyde; Gordon B. Fillman, Attorney; Michael K. Hyde; James M. Hyde, II; Unknown Does, 1 to 100, Appellees. Submitted: July 2, 1997 Filed: January 16, 1998 Before McMILLIAN, FAGG and LOKEN, Circuit Judges. PER CURIAM. Charles V. Hyde appeals from a final order of the United States District Court1 for the District of Nebraska, dismissing his complaint with prejudice for failing to comply with Federal Rule of Civil Procedure 8, and denying his motion for summary judgment. We have carefully reviewed the record and we affirm on the basis of the district court's opinion. See 8th Cir. R. 47B. A true copy. Attest: CLERK, U. S. COURT OF APPEALS, EIGHTH CIRCUIT.
